Enregistrement de macros "étrange"

Bonjour à tous,

je rencontre un problème assez bizarre avec Excel 2016, à priori depuis une récente mise à jour de Windows:

Lors de l'enregistrement de macros, même très simples, le code généré semble ne pas correspondre à ce qui a été fait et, surtout, affiche des erreurs et ne peut pas être exécuté.

Nous utilisons la même version d'Excel sur beaucoup de postes et seulement sur un PC je rencontre ce problème.

Voici un exemple de code généré, pour un simple copié collé d'une plage de cellules (de G12 à Gxx, à copier en colonne P)

Je ne vois pas comment ce code pourrait fonctionner (d'ailleurs il ne fonctionne pas )

Sub Macro3() ' ' Macro3 Macro ' ' Range("G12").DataFields Item(, .VLookup(xlDown)).DataFields . ThemeColor. := 1 ThemeColor. = 61 ThemeColor. = 46 ThemeColor. = 1 ThemeColor. = 3 ThemeColor. := 3 Range("P10").DataFields ColorIndex.Paste End Sub

Voici également une capture d'écran, afin de montrer à quoi ça ressemble dans Excel:

macroetrange

Je ne comprends pas d'où peut venir le problème.

J'avais déjà rencontré ça il y a quelques mois et, il me semble, l'avait résolu en désinstallant et réinstallant Office. Mais si il y avait une solution plus simple, ou une explication, ça serait encore mieux !

Merci d'avance pour votre aide !

Bonjour,

Commence par faire une réparation de MS Office, à partir du panneau de configuration, Programmes et fonctionnalités.

Cdlt.

En effet, je peux essayer ça.

Il me semble que je l'avais déjà essayé, mais je n'en suis plus sûr.

Merci !

Désolé pour cette réponse très tardive,

en fait la réparation n'a pas suffit. Mais une désinstallation complète puis réinstallation a réglé le soucis.

Merci pour le tuyau.

Rechercher des sujets similaires à "enregistrement macros etrange"